Grid Engine and Apple OS X Launchd
This is a follow-up post relating to the new Apple framework for starting, stopping and managing persistent daemons and services called "launchd". The issue of Grid Engine interoperability with the launchd framework has already been covered in a gridengine.info Wiki article.
The new news to report is that my coworker Bill Van Etten stumbled upon the SGE environment variable "SGE_ND" and realized that it could be useful for Apple launchd integration because launchd really hates daemons that fork off ASAP upon startup. By setting the "SGE_ND" variable to true, the daemons don't fork and can be better managed by launchd.
